Study on Reducing Barriers to Minority Participation in Elite Units in the Armed Services
Abstract
Section 557 of the Fiscal Year (FY) 2021 National Defense Authorization Act (NDAA) requires the Department of Defense (DOD) to sponsor an independent study to assess barriers to racial/ethnic minority and women's participation in Special Operation Forces (SOF) and other specialties (i.e., pilot and combat systems officer specialties, Marine Corps Force Reconnaissance, and Coast Guard Maritime Security Response Team). DOD asked the Institute for Defense Analyses (IDA) to conduct this research. This IDA paper examines racial/ethnic and gender composition of SOF and other specialties, assesses progress on past recommendations, and examines the results of focus groups to understand barriers and facilitators to participation throughout the career cycle.
